Just read a very interesting piece on the state of Maryland basketball from The Athletic that I woke up to in my inbox this AM. I'll provide a link so folks can read it. But thought I'd mention a couple of things really stood out to me....

1. Damon Evans says the plan is to raise the remaining 8 mil needed to get started on the basketball practice facility 'by the time the new coach is here.' He added he's very confident the money will be in place in the next month. Also said it will take at least 18 months to get the facility built once construction is started.

2. An anonymous agent that represents multiple high-profile coaches says, 'its a top-10 job and I'll tell you why: proximity to talent.'

Finally, I thought Len Elmore's comments about how Turgeon was treated were very telling. “You know, Mark wasn’t treated that badly, and I’m sure he’d be the first to admit it,” Elmore continues. “A lot of it had to do with the person he is. He’s a good guy. He’s a good coach. But at some point in a 10-year period, with the commitment and the resources of the university, if you haven’t gotten closer to the Promised Land than the Sweet 16, then it’s time to change.”
